Leadership support and role modeling for wellness.

Leadership plays a crucial role in fostering a culture of wellness within organizations. In this blog, we’ll delve into the importance of leadership support and role modeling in promoting employee well-being, and how it contributes to a positive work environment.

Understanding Leadership Support for Wellness

Leadership support for wellness encompasses actions taken by organizational leaders to prioritize and encourage practices that enhance employee health and well-being. This can include initiatives, policies, and personal behaviors that promote physical, mental, and emotional wellness among staff.

Key Aspects of Leadership Support

1. Advocacy and Communication:
Effective leaders advocate for wellness programs and initiatives, communicating their importance to the organization’s overall mission and values. This fosters a culture where employee well-being is seen as integral to organizational success.

2. Implementation of Wellness Programs:
Leaders play a pivotal role in implementing and funding wellness programs, such as fitness activities, mental health resources, ergonomic improvements, and health screenings. They ensure these programs align with employee needs and organizational goals.

3. Role Modeling Healthy Behaviors:
Leaders who model healthy behaviors inspire employees to prioritize their own well-being. This includes maintaining work-life balance, taking breaks, participating in wellness activities, and demonstrating stress management techniques.

Benefits of Leadership Support for Wellness

Improved Employee Morale: Employees feel valued and supported, leading to higher job satisfaction and morale.
Increased Productivity: Healthy employees are more engaged and productive, contributing to overall organizational performance.
Retention and Recruitment: Organizations that prioritize wellness attract and retain talent, enhancing their reputation as an employer of choice.
